Who Needs an Appraisal?
A written appraisal by a qualified appraiser is necessary for insurance.
Appraisals document your collections and substantiate the value
of your collection if you have a damage and loss situation.
Appraisals
are often needed to settle an estate especially when there may
be disagreement amongst legatees. When equitable distribution
is required as in divorce cases, an appraisal is often advised.
When a sizable charitable donation is given to a non-profit group such as a museum or historical
society an appraisal is required.
Appraisals are also appropriate
if you wish to learn the value of your collections. A qualified
appraiser is one who has had rigorous training and testing in appraisal
methodology and is knowledgeable in his or her area of expertise. |
